Polvorones (Mexican Wedding Cakes) - cooking recipe

Ingredients
    1/2 cup vegetable shortening
    1/2 cup butter (do not use margarine)
    1/2 cup sugar
    2 large egg yolks, only
    1/4 cup orange juice
    2 oranges, zest of
    4 cups all-purpose flour
    powdered sugar, to taste
Preparation
    Preheat oven to 400^F.
    In a large bowl, beat shortening and butter until fluffy.
    Add sugar a little bit at a time.
    Add egg yolks, orange juice, and peel.
    Stir in flour with spatula.
    On a floured surface, roll out the dough to 3/4\". Cut out 2 1/2\" circles and place them on a greased baking sheet. Roll the dough scraps and continue to roll until all the dough is used.
    Bake for 25 minutes. Be careful not to overcook them--they are done when they are barely starting to tan.
    Transfer to a rack to cool.
    Sprinkle with powdered sugar through a fine sieve.
